Type
ORACLE
Validation date
2023-09-19 23:06: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03598,
    "usd": 0.03933
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000127293AD30928EDED4BF6CAF22FA3BB8908647B99251027F17F6F54411C643251

Previous signature

ADE14C2E0F9E36357476AD8022C2A17297F8F8DC1E58D4E0A7750F1C69E941EBB2BD9C128D83849272C32C1D0E193CA7E788D6A52ADAB7340E68BADA0A6A230F

Origin signature

3044022070D83DE2B13D0A94CD038572265086153DEEA3AE74B64B9112C17CF27A30794F0220484B5F7B29D59CE39D677139E41A73D52355620208AE1A2331F48D6C95CE84A0

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

00C37DF178D384C4777357EEF9830841F17115103C97319495C4CC757F08629B21

Coordinator signature

20D3B2739622B1455E6F54907FB3020A282A7779F387584E08BAACEC6CA0D8097C867A7F64FE4EC8F25B3C30E8C6AD8D46A536256111ADC3DF4D4D4F3558C001

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

8914C24D125E236B7B140AFBACC029CCB8B824FB8CD43193FE1A83AFF0D906DB2B65BAF8E39B816234AE6404C0F52037801F4CAED069BEFAF73E561C05215C0B

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

3599E619EBDA996DDBB65AC20BDD201A8485EA6D764D3A2AE15EF7585D2FFD134D100B3FDD21666F8F0CF093DD94B9F29A916B8B7B81C27319F1B10E86750F0E